在数字化浪潮席卷全球的今天,网络安全已成为企业和个人用户最为关注的问题之一,随着互联网技术的飞速发展,个人信息泄露、数据盗窃等安全事件层出不穷,撞库攻击”作为一种常见的网络攻击手段,其危害性和隐蔽性日益凸显,本文将深入探讨撞库攻击的定义、原理、影响以及有效的防御措施,帮助读者构建起坚实的网络安全防线。

什么是撞库攻击?

撞库攻击,又称为暴力破解攻击,是一种利用数据库查询漏洞对多个目标进行尝试登录的攻击方式,攻击者通过收集大量用户名和密码,然后使用这些信息对目标网站或服务进行登录尝试,由于大多数网站和服务都采用用户名和密码作为登录凭证,因此一旦成功,攻击者即可获得访问权限。

撞库攻击的原理

撞库攻击的核心在于收集并分析大量的用户名和密码,攻击者通常通过以下几种途径获取这些信息:

  1. 公开数据库:攻击者可以从公开的数据库中获取用户名和密码,这些数据库可能包括社交媒体账户、邮箱服务提供商、在线购物平台等。
  2. 黑市交易:一些不法分子会购买或出售被盗的用户名和密码,这些信息往往来源于各种网络钓鱼攻击或恶意软件泄露。
  3. 内部泄露:企业内部员工因疏忽或故意行为导致敏感信息外泄,成为撞库攻击的源头。
  4. 第三方服务:一些第三方服务如云存储、电子邮件服务等可能因为安全问题导致用户信息泄露。

撞库攻击的影响

撞库攻击的危害不容小觑,它不仅可能导致个人隐私泄露,还可能引发更严重的安全事件,如勒索软件感染、数据篡改等,撞库攻击还会给企业带来经济损失,因为它们需要投入大量资源来应对不断重复的登录尝试,这不仅增加了运营成本,还可能影响正常的业务运营。

如何防御撞库攻击?

面对撞库攻击的威胁,企业和个人的防御措施至关重要,以下是一些有效的防御策略:

  1. 强化密码管理:鼓励用户使用复杂的密码组合,定期更换密码,并避免在多个账户中使用相同的密码。
  2. 限制登录尝试次数:许多网站和服务允许用户在一定时间内限制登录尝试的次数,以减少被撞库攻击的风险。
  3. 使用双因素认证:双因素认证(2FA)为账户添加一层额外的保护,即使密码被破解,也需要第二重验证才能登录。
  4. 及时更新软件:确保所有使用的软件和系统都保持最新状态,修补已知的安全漏洞。
  5. 监控异常登录活动:定期检查账户登录活动,对于短时间内多次尝试登录的情况要引起注意。
  6. 使用沙箱技术:在测试新功能或开发新应用时,使用沙箱环境隔离潜在的风险。
  7. 加强数据加密:对敏感数据进行加密处理,防止数据在传输过程中被截获。
  8. 建立应急响应机制:制定应急预案,一旦发现撞库攻击迹象,立即启动应急响应程序。
  9. 法律与政策支持:政府应出台相关法律法规,加大对网络犯罪的打击力度,同时企业也应加强内部管理,提高员工的安全意识。

撞库攻击是网络安全领域的一大挑战,它不仅威胁着个人和企业的数据安全,还可能引发更广泛的安全事件,通过上述防御措施的实施,我们可以在很大程度上降低撞库攻击的风险,保护好我们的数字资产。

admin 更新于 3周前